Transaction 89a7652941e1d6f351d9e3796f81d58de79ccc5e90b20bc4cc8d18fb942b23e4
1 Input
1 Output
-
89a7652941e1d6f351d9e3796f81d58de79ccc5e90b20bc4cc8d18fb942b23e4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c33eb6fc5092f1575ca44b062484c8cf45c61ebcae97c08b9e421d1fb1467e50
- address
- bc1pcvltdlzsjtc4wh9yfvrzfpxgeazuv84u46tupzu7ggw3lv2x0egqkukwra